Responsibilities & Context

Job Context:

Ensure excellent service standards, maintain quality of service, respond efficiently to the need of the authority and develop customer as well as management satisfaction as priority.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Assist in preparing purchase requisitions and collecting quotations.
  • Support vendor selection, negotiation, and follow-up for timely delivery.
  • Maintain updated records of suppliers, price lists, and purchase agreements.
  • Ensure procurement follows hospital policy and cost-effectiveness.

Store & Inventory Management

  • Receive, verify, and record incoming goods (medical consumables, equipment, pharmacy items, general supplies).
  • Maintain proper stock levels through routine checks and audits.
  • Monitor expiry dates, batch numbers, and ensure first-in-first-out (FIFO) usage.
  • Issue items to departments as per approved requisitions.
  • Keep the store area clean, organized, and compliant with safety standards.

Documentation & Reporting

  • Maintain computerized records of purchases and stock using HMS/ERP or manual registers.
  • Prepare daily/weekly/monthly stock and purchase reports.
  • Report shortages, discrepancies, and damaged items immediately to the supervisor.
  • Assist in annual stock-taking and audits.
